Bermudians dug a little deeper into their pockets this Christmas with gross revenue in the retail sector increasing 5.1 per cent.

Those travelling home from trips overseas declared purchases worth $3.38 million -- an increase of 11.2 per cent over the previous year.

The total value of all retail sales for the 12 months of 1994 was $491.5 million.
